Why Material Handling Matters in Construction
All construction projects have the constant shifting of heavy materials, tools and equipment. Cement, steel, testing equipment, aggregates and other materials are routinely moved around the jobsite by workers.
Employees frequently use manual lifting and carrying if they do not have the material handling equipment. This can lead to strains, sprains and other musculoskeletal injuries as well as reduce productivity. Repetitive lifting also can cause fatigue in the worker, which increases the risk for costly mistakes and/or accidents.
Modern material handling equipment can mitigate these risks by safely and efficiently moving materials, while keeping physical strain to a minimum.
Ensure Safe Material Testing Operations
The material testing laboratories are vital role in the construction quality assurance process. These sites regularly move around concrete cylinders, soil samples, asphalt samples, sieves, laboratory equipment and other specialized equipment that requires careful handling during transportation.
Handling can damage the expensive testing equipment or result in a compromise to the integrity of the sample may have an impact on the results of the tests and the project timeline.
Purchasing the right carts and platform trucks, lift tables and other materials handling solutions enable technicians to move materials safely, while keeping the laboratory organized and efficient. It also minimises unnecessary handling, which helps to maintain test specimen and equipment integrity.
Reducing Workplace Injuries
Manual material handling continues to be a major source of work injuries throughout the industrial workplace. Common issues include:
- Injuries from lifting heavy objects
- Any strain to the neck and shoulders.
- Carrying materials in a slippery manner causing slips and falls.
- Injuries to the hands and wrists from repetitive activities
These risks can be greatly reduced if employers establish correct handling procedures and provide workers with the proper equipment used for safe load transportation.
Correct training of workers in the use of material handling equipment is also important. A safe work environment is achieved through safe operating practices, routine inspections and proper load management.

Safe lifting, carrying and handling practices
Equipment investments are just part of an effective safety strategy. There should also be clear material handling procedures in place at the organization.
The following are a few suggested best practices:
- Provide training on correct lifting techniques and operation of lifting equipment.
- Regularly inspect carts, trucks and lifting equipment.
- Clean and clear walkways.
- Do not exceed recommended loads.
- Place items that are used often in convenient places.
- Arrange for preventive maintenance for handling equipment.
- Promptly report equipment damage by workers.
These can make a big effect on the number of incidents in the workplace and the life expectancy of equipment.
